区块链技术常见问题解答
区块链技术自提出以来,成为了许多人关注的焦点。从金融到供应链,再到身份验证等多个领域,它的应用潜力无疑是巨大的。然而,由于技术的复杂性和市场上的信息繁杂,许多人对区块链依然有许多疑问。本文将针对一些常见问题进行解答,以帮助大家更好地理解这一前沿技术。
首先,什么是区块链?
区块链是一种分布式账本技术,其核心特征是将数据以“区块”的形式存储,并通过“链”将这些区块连接起来。每个区块中包含了一定数量的交易信息,并通过密码学手段确保数据的安全性与完整性。与传统数据库不同,区块链数据不是集中存储的,而是分布在网络中的多个节点上。这种去中心化的特性使得区块链在防篡改、透明性和可信任度方面具有明显优势。
第二,区块链如何保证数据的安全性?
区块链利用密码学原理来保证数据的安全性。每个区块都包含了上一个区块的哈希值,形成了一个不可更改的链条。如果有人试图篡改某个区块的数据,所需调整的其它区块的哈希值也会随之改变,最终导致整个链的数据不一致。因此,任何对区块链数据的篡改都是极其困难的。此外,通过使用共识机制(如PoW或PoS),网络中的节点需要达成一致来确认交易,从而确保了数据的真实性和安全性。
第三,区块链与比特币有什么关系?
比特币是第一个将区块链技术应用于数字货币的项目。区块链技术为比特币提供了安全、透明和去中心化的支付系统。比特币的成功推动了人们对区块链技术的关注,促使各种应用场景的探索。然而,区块链的应用远不止于数字货币,它在供应链管理、智能合约、身份验证等方面都有着广泛的应用。
第四,区块链的可扩展性问题如何解决?
区块链的可扩展性问题是指网络在处理大量交易时可能出现的性能瓶颈。为了解决这一问题,研究者和开发者提出了多种解决方案,如分层协议、侧链、分片技术等。其中,分层协议将处理交易的任务分为不同层级,减轻主链的负担;侧链则允许不同区块链之间的交互,增加整体网络的流动性;而分片技术则是通过将数据切分成多个部分,提高交易处理速度。
第五,如何选择合适的区块链平台?
选择合适的区块链平台需考虑多个因素,包括项目需求、技术支持、社区活跃度、安全性和可扩展性等。如果希望创建私有链,可以考虑Hyperledger或Quorum等,而若是需要建立公有链,则可以选择以太坊、Solana等。目前,不同的区块链平台各有特点,适用于不同的业务场景。
第六,区块链的未来发展趋势是什么?
区块链技术的发展前景广阔,未来可能集中在几个方向:首先,性能和可扩展性将持续改进,支持更大规模的应用;其次,跨链技术将进一步发展,实现不同区块链之间的数据互操作性;最后,随着企业对区块链应用的认知加深,更多行业将探索区块链解决方案,从而推动技术的标准化和合规化。
总结而言,区块链技术是一种颠覆性创新,能够为多个行业带来巨大的变革。尽管在技术、法律和政策等方面仍面临挑战,但随着研究的不断深入与应用的逐步扩展,区块链的未来将充满可能性。希望通过上述问题解答,能够帮助更多人理解和关注这一重要技术。